Radiology Technician Jobs in Oswego, NY
A Radiology Technician, also referred to as a Radiologic Technologist, plays an integral role in the radiology field. They are responsible for operating complex medical imaging equipment, such as X-ray, computed tomography, or magnetic resonance imaging machines to help diagnose and treat illnesses and injuries. Their duties include explaining procedures to patients, positioning them to get the most accurate images, and ensuring patient safety during the process. The images produced by Radiology Technicians are then interpreted by Radiologists to provide diagnosis or treatment plans.
Important skills for a Radiology Technician include attention to detail, the ability to work with complex machinery, good communication skills, and empathy for patients. They should also have a good understanding of anatomy, physiology, and radiology principles. Radiology Technicians should have an associate's degree in Radiologic Technology and must be certified by The American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T). Prior to becoming a Radiology Technician, an individual may have been a Medical Assistant, a Certified Nursing Assistant, or a Medical Imaging Assistant. These roles provide relevant experience in patient care and medical environments that can be beneficial in a radiology setting.
